Welcome to Seeds of Triumph, a podcast directed towards service members who are looking for support, tools, resources and techniques on dealing with the stress and challenges that serving in the military can bring. Our goal is to provide a platform for service members and mental health advocates to come together and provide their own personal stories of triumph, experience and knowledge with hopes to create a community of support. The hosts will interview and speak with various guests who have remained triumphant through the lowest points in their lives. Seeds of Triumph is here to help you through the navigating challenging experiences, facing adversity, and equipping you with the tools and resources you need to persevere through the hardest days and remain TRIUMPHANT!     Seed#9: "Bad Things Happen to Good People"

    SOT talks to Ryan Sweazey, Retired Air Force Fighter Pilot and founder of the Walk the talk Foundation. The Walk the Talk Foundation is committed to helping the military navigate through the Department of Defense Inspector General (IG) System and ensure they remain free from reprisal and retribution. Ryan and his foundation also provide legal, and mental health resources for those who will utilize his services, all free of charge. In addition to learning about the Walk the Talk Foundation, we also learn more about the DOD IG System and discuss some of the shortcomings within it as well as how Ryan intends to address and improve the IG system for the future of our military. Ryan is the perfect example of triumph!
